About

Tianjiao Li is a Ph.D. student in Operations Research at the H. Milton School of Industrial and Systems Engineering. He is co-advised by Prof. George Lan and Prof. Ashwin Pananjady. Prior to joining Georgia Tech, Tianjiao earned his B.S. degree in Mathematics from Fudan University, China. He also earned an M.S. degree in Quantitative and Computational Finance from Georgia Tech. Tianjiao’s primary research interests lie in the design and analysis of optimization algorithms, with an emphasis on fast implementation and computational efficiency.
